Rationale for investing in consultations
- Need for conducting national consultations to mitigate conservation issues
- Need for dialogue between forest departments, scientists and conservationists to device conservation strategies
- Submit conservation recommendations to MoEF for rapid action
- Encourage the print and television media to highlight real conservation issues on a regular basis
- Come up with a policy for tourism in wilderness areas
- Popularise conservation issues among the masses
- Educate and inform the student and teacher community

Rationale
- Local NGOs/individuals are well verse with issues at the grass-root level
- Greater and more-effective interventions possible by aligning with life goals of NGOs/individuals
- Funding is often a limiting factor in remote, wildlife areas
- Funds help in capacity building of these organisations/individuals
- Helps expand their horizon
- Further WCT’s conservation goals
